Meeting Mr. Thomas by Rene Thomas, released on Barclay in 1963.

Marc Myers wrote for Jazz Wax:

"One of my favorite recordings by Thomas is Meeting Mister Thomas for the French Barclay label. On this album from 1963, Thomas led a quintet featuring saxophonist and flutist Jacques Pelzer, organist Lou Bennett, bassist Gilbert Rovere and drummer Charles Bellonzi. Thomas' sound in the early 1960s was ambitious, robust and modern, with enormous optimism built in. He employed a spirited technique that never gave hint that a pick was being used on the strings. Imagine a woodpecker hammering away on a rubber tree. Add Bennett's organ, and the group's sound was remarkably cool and distinctly European—swift but never frantic..."

Today's selection in Jazz is from a tribute concert to Germany's Jazz giant, bassist Eberhard Weber. Now in his 80's, in 2015 ECM Records put together an album celebrating his compositions and influence on European Jazz. The tune I'm sharing today is Tübingen as arranged for the SWR Big Band. Joining the band are Gary Burton whom I consider the GOAT on Vibes and Paul McCandless on English Horn (famous for his role in the band Oregon). Enjoy! #jazz #eurojazz #bigband

Today's jazz selection is from Poland. The Marcin Wasilewski Trio is a wonderful reminder of how beautiful jazz trios can be with the intricacies of tonal colors and space. I especially love the brush work from the drummer as it is a bit of a lesser known art these days. So mellow out and be ready to just listen and slow down. This is Austin by the Marcin Wasilewski Trio. #jazz #eurojazz

Today's jazz selection is another Euro-jazz album Neighborhood, from French drummer Manu Katché on ECM records. Manu has played with everyone in Pop music and European Jazz and is well known as the drummer for Sting. The groove of "Number One" is smooth but relentless. In many ways this selection is reminiscent of of some of the best mid-sixties Herbie Hancock recordings. So sit back and enjoy! #jazz #eurojazz #drums

Today's jazz clip is from another Scandinavian country, Sweden. The Esbjörn Svensson Trio is beautifully melancholy. Unfortunately Esbjörn passed too early so the recordings are limited, but this one is a favorite of mine.
